An accident with an antique pistol cut short the life and career of the "Third" great early crooner, Russ Columbo, at 26...

Along with Rudy Vallee and Bing Crosby, Columbo dominated the hit parade of the early 30's...and the heartstrings of millions of adoring fans.

Rudy Vallee's self-parodying performance of the song (serenading Claudette Colbert) in "Palm Beach Story" sparked a 40's revival of the tune.
